Is Town Course Heights Safe?
Town Course Heights in Chaska, MN has a safety grade of A+. The overall crime index is 21, which is 79% below the national average of 100.
Compared to the Chaska average (crime index 68), Town Course Heights is 47% lower in overall crime. This neighborhood is significantly safer than Chaska as a whole, making it an attractive option for safety-conscious residents.
Looking at specific crime types, rape is the most elevated concern (index: 46, 54% below average), while murder is the lowest risk (index: 12).
Overall, Town Course Heights is considered a safe neighborhood for residents and visitors. Standard urban awareness is recommended, but the area benefits from lower-than-average crime rates across most categories.
